Title : 
P2P live video streaming in WebRTC
         
        
            Author : 
Rhinow, Florian ; Veloso, Pablo Porto ; Puyelo, Carlos ; Barrett, Samuel ; Nuallain, Eamonn O.
         
        
            Author_Institution : 
Sch. of Comput. Sci. & Stat., Trinity Coll. Dublin, Dublin, Ireland
         
        
        
        
        
        
            Abstract : 
In this paper, we analyse the feasibility of implementing live video streaming protocols into web applications with the use of WebRTC. As a result of demand the distribution of video content requires ever increasing bandwidth. Although, specialised programs exist to distribute video content efficiently, web pages have up until recently not been able to leverage these technologies. WebRTC could serve as a solution by enabling peer-to-peer communication directly between browsers without any need for a server as an intermediary. The feasibility analysisis accompanied by a practical implementation of a peer-to-peer streaming protocol in WebRTC that runs natively in all browsers and an identification of optimal settings for such a protocol. Our work highlights current limitations and future challenges when implementing sophisticated peer-to-peer solutions using a technology that is still in its infancy. Finally, we provide preliminary experimental data on WebRTC which measures the performance of such a system in a laboratory environment.
         
        
            Keywords : 
peer-to-peer computing; protocols; video streaming; P2P live video streaming protocols; WebRTC; peer-to-peer communication; peer-to-peer streaming protocol; Bandwidth; Browsers; Peer-to-peer computing; Protocols; Servers; Streaming media; WebRTC;
         
        
        
        
            Conference_Titel : 
Computer Applications and Information Systems (WCCAIS), 2014 World Congress on
         
        
            Conference_Location : 
Hammamet
         
        
            Print_ISBN : 
978-1-4799-3350-1
         
        
        
            DOI : 
10.1109/WCCAIS.2014.6916588